<h1 class="topictitle1">What Storage Options Does <span id="en-us_topic_0076828131_text887253839145630">CSS</span> Provide?</h1>
<div id="body8662426"><p id="css_02_0008__en-us_topic_0076828131_p46058374172"><span id="css_02_0008__en-us_topic_0076828131_text323513111100">CSS</span> uses EVS and local disks to store your indices. During cluster creation, you can specify the EVS disk type and specifications (the EVS disk size).</p>
<ul id="css_02_0008__en-us_topic_0076828131_ul205641122141814"><li id="css_02_0008__en-us_topic_0076828131_li1956415223184">Supported EVS disk types include common I/O, high I/O, and ultra-high I/O.</li><li id="css_02_0008__en-us_topic_0076828131_li938912592116">The EVS disk size varies depending on the node specifications selected when you create a cluster.</li></ul>
